Approach to care

My approach to care is to have an open, honest dialogue about food and nutrition - how eating makes us feel both physically and mentally! I have an "all foods fit" approach, meaning, I think that having an adequate number of fruits and vegetables in your daily diet is just as important as being able to enjoy a scoop of ice cream after dinner while still obtaining your nutrition goals. I love to set short term, realistic goals that can help your reach your long-term health goals.
